As The World Went By.

I thought I loved
As my youth went by –
Time passed, my curious eye
Often watched in wonder…
Under, my stoic gaze…
(Sometimes – in a drunken haze)…
Lost carefree days, in those wayward ways.
Then, when thunder dashed the dream
It seemed hurt raged – supreme
Lost alone in desolation
No aspiration to face another day…
Smashed a heart in tears
Memories to stab as souvenirs.
She smiled across that Rubicon stream
A tempting – dream so sweet…
How incomplete my past then seemed
As tempting paths led to – no more sorrow
Each golden tomorrow – I snatched to borrow
That love that comes without the barbed arrow
Freely given – but with trust
Some would say like angle dust.
Now I no longer cry.
